Tel Aviv [Israel]: Benjamin Netanyahu, the Israeli prime minister, declared on Saturday (local time) that Israel will keep up its actions against Iran until all objectives were met. He also commended Israel’s defence forces and people for their valiant stance in the face of growing hostilities in the West Asian region.
In a video message posted on X, he made the comments in Hebrew.
“We are in the midst of a fateful campaign for our survival; in the past week, we have acted with strength, initiative, and resolve against our enemies, and we will continue to act with all our might until we achieve all of our objectives. I thank our pilots, fighters, ground personnel, security and rescue teams, and you–Israeli citizens–for your unwavering spirit, duty, and heroic stand,” the message read.
It further stated, “Together, we have changed the face of the Middle East.” We shall continue to fight, and we will roar like lions. And with God’s guidance, we shall assure Israel’s eternal existence.”

He stated, “Our achievement will result in not only the elimination of the nuclear menace to the entire world, but also peace between Israel and Iran. It will also result in a significant extension of the circle of calm surrounding us. Today, everyone recognises that the Ayatollahs’ dictatorship endangers the entire globe. Iran has recently launched attacks on 12 neighbouring countries. “We stand with them.”All of these countries recognise Israel’s enormous power, our willingness to battle the tyrants in Tehran, the bravery of our army and people, and our immense military and scientific capacities. Many countries are turning to us. I’m telling you, many countries are now seeking us for collaboration,” Netanyahu said.
The announcement follows a number of developments in West Asia and the Gulf.

Meanwhile, the Israel Defence Forces announced on Saturday that it had attacked two major ballistic missile development sites in Parchin and Shahrud. According to the IDF, the targets included factories producing explosive materials for ballistic missile warheads, complexes producing unique raw materials for missile engines, a missile engine mixing and casting facility, and a complex used for research, development, assembly, and production of advanced cruise missiles.
Earlier, Dubai Media Office reported that police had confirmed the death of a Pakistani motorist in the Al Barsha area after debris from an aerial interception collided with a vehicle. It further stated that police confirmed a minor incident on the front of a tower in Dubai Marina, with no injuries recorded.
Meanwhile, the IRNA reported on Sunday, citing the IRGC, that a refinery in Haifa was targeted. According to a post on X, “IRGC: The Haifa refinery was struck by Kheibarshekan missiles.”

According to Al Jazeera Breaking, airstrikes attacked an oil storage facility in Tehran. Hezbollah also claimed to have launched missiles at the Haifa naval facility and fired rockets toward Kiryat Shmona.
The Jerusalem Post reported on Saturday night, citing IDF sources, that the Israeli Air Force bombed significant oil resources in Tehran, Iran. According to the sources, the oil resources targeted are intimately related to Iran’s military industrial complex.
The battle in West Asia has now expanded to include numerous Gulf countries.
These developments come after growing tensions erupted following a joint US-Israeli military operation on Iranian territory on February 28 that killed the country’s Supreme Leader, Ayatollah Ali Khamenei, and other senior individuals, triggering a harsh response from Tehran.
In response, Iran launched ballistic missiles and drones at US assets and allies in the region, including Israel, Bahrain, Kuwait, Qatar,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ates, and Jordan, exacerbating the conflict in West Asia and increasing risks for civilians and expatriates alike.
